About Hege Wang

Hege Wang is a scholar working on Applied Microbiology and Biotechnology, Family Practice and Oncology, having authored 9 papers that have together received 384 indexed citations. Recurring topics across this work include Global Cancer Incidence and Screening (6 papers), Colorectal Cancer Screening and Detection (4 papers) and Cancer Risks and Factors (3 papers). The work is most often cited by research in Cancer Research (198 citations), Oncology (283 citations) and Pathology and Forensic Medicine (77 citations). Hege Wang has collaborated with scholars based in Norway, Sweden and Denmark. Frequent co-authors include Steinar Thoresen, Audun Braaten, Solveig Hofvind, Geir Egil Eide, Ingunn M. Stefansson, Karin Collett, Johan Eide, William D. Foulkes, Lars A. Akslen and Rolf Kåresen. Their work appears in journals such as Radiology, International Journal of Cancer and Cancer Epidemiology Biomarkers & Prevention.
